Output 24a63d81acb7c45df94903479d578ea2b959440875d51b17d11d8e4b3f81be65:1

value
1544408
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d71054b619917ecfbe60e495685e2928a85d115 OP_EQUALVERIFY OP_CHECKSIG
address
1JGg756PYXX8CnJyVSEZNQqQ24TpPfYLnx
transaction
24a63d81acb7c45df94903479d578ea2b959440875d51b17d11d8e4b3f81be65
spent
true